Crustaceans, moist heat, cooked, wild, mixed species, crayfish contains 82 calories per 100 g serving. This serving contains 1.2 g of fat, 17 g of protein and 0 g of carbohydrate. The latter is 0 g sugar and 0 g of dietary fiber, the rest is complex carbohydrate. Crustaceans, moist heat, cooked, wild, mixed species, crayfish contains 0.2 g of saturated fat and 133 mg of cholesterol per serving. 100 g of Crustaceans, moist heat, cooked, wild, mixed species, crayfish contains 15.00 mcg vitamin A, 0.9 mg vitamin C, 0.00 mcg vitamin D as well as 0.83 mg of iron, 60.00 mg of calcium, 296 mg of potassium. Crustaceans, moist heat, cooked, wild, mixed species, crayfish belong to 'Finfish and Shellfish Products' food category.
